Le Châtelier’s Principle

If stress is applied to a system the system shifts to relieve the stress

Le Châtelier’s Principle

Mountains and mole-hills:

If stress is added the reaction must shift in the opposite direction to “remove” the mountain

If stress is removed the hole must shift in the same direction to “fill in” the hole

Remember that decreasing volume

is also increasing pressure If pressure is increased, the

reaction shifts to the side with the least amount of moles

If heat is on the right side of the

reaction, it is exothermic If heat is on the left side of the

reaction, it is endothermic
